POSITION SUMMARY:
The Early Learning Assistant Teacher at YMCA of the Black Hills maintains a supportive, positive atmosphere that welcomes and respects all individuals, promotes the potential of all youth, and provides a quality experience to both youth and their families.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S/PERFORMANCE OBJECTIVES:
- Ensure the safety and security of each child in your care
- Nurture children through purposeful programming, implement mission based, age-appropriate curricula as set forth by the lead teacher.
- Develop and maintain positive relationships with all youth in your care
- Handles and resolves membership concerns and informs supervisor of unusual situations or unresolved issues.
- Provides and welcomes ongoing positive dialog and relations with YMCA families.
- Complete continuing education annual requirements.
- Maintain excellent room appearance and proper maintenance and use of equipment, supplies, and materials.
- Learn and actively implement YMCA Social and Emotional Curriculum, Conscious Discipline.
- Completes opening and closing procedures as required.
- Follow all childcare policies and procedures as set forth in the childcare employ handbook
- Applies all YMCA safety and emergency procedures and state and local codes.
- Accurately complete an incident/accident report for each incident/accident and submit and report it in accordance with staff training.

QUALIFICATIONS:
- Minimum of 16 years of age.
- Be able to lift 25 lbs
- Have an understanding of growth and development
- Meet qualifications needed for South Dakota State Childcare Licensing
- CPR/AED and First Aid Certifications required within 60 days of hire, other YMCA required training within 60 days of hire.
- Excellent interpersonal and problem-solving skills.
- Ability to relate effectively to diverse groups of people from all social and economic segments of the community.
- Be passionate about the YMCA mission and vision and must personally advocate and demonstrate the core values of honesty, respect, responsibility and caring.
- Basic knowledge of computers.
WORK ENVIRONMENT & PHYSICAL DEMANDS:
- The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Consistently demonstrate the YMCA core values of honesty, respect, responsibility and caring.
- The employee frequently is required to sit on the floor, bend, balance and reach and must be able to move around the work environment.
- The employee must be able to regularly lift and/or move up to 50 pounds.
- The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
- See details of objects that are less than a few feet away.
- See details of objects that are more than a few feet away.
